3) Hmmm I asked a similar question on vceonline.com.au (completely inferior to vcenotes.com of course). The question was:

If you are ranked first in your SACs, does that mean you automatically get the highest exam mark for your whole class? And if you are ranked second, does that mean you will also automatically get the second highest exam mark?

Someone said: If your ranked first in your SACs, and your subject is 50% exam and 50% SACs, then you will get the top exam mark from your school in that subject as your SAC score in that subject and you will retain your exam score. You will always keep whatever your exam score is for your exam component of the subject, it's just your SAC score will be determined by how the class performs on the exam. If your ranked second, it won't necessarily mean you will get the second highest exam mark, but it will mean your SAC mark will be (pretty much) whatever the second highest exam mark someone from your class has got.
